Human waste will quickly be capable to gasoline your vacation flights after a world-first manufacturing facility was introduced.

The commercial-scale manufacturing facility changing human waste to sustainable aviation gasoline (Saf) will likely be in-built Essex.

Biofuel firm Firefly mentioned it should develop the plant in Harwich and expects to start supplying the decrease carbon gasoline from round 2028.

It has reached an settlement with Wizz Air to supply as much as 525,000 tonnes of Saf over 15 years.

Utility firm Anglian Water has dedicated to offering biosolids – a product of its wastewater remedy course of – to Firefly for an preliminary pilot Saf facility.

Saf is produced from sustainable sources that means its manufacturing includes utilizing about 70% much less carbon than standard jet gasoline.

It may be utilized in a most mix of fifty% with kerosene with out the necessity for any modifications to plane engines.

Saf is at the moment a number of occasions dearer to provide than standard jet gasoline.

Firefly chief govt James Hygate mentioned biosolids are “type of disgusting stuff” however “a tremendous useful resource”.

He went on: “We’re turning sewage into jet gasoline. I can’t actually consider many issues which can be cooler than that.”

Paul Hilditch, the corporate’s chief working officer, mentioned: “There’s sufficient biosolids within the UK for greater than 200,000 tonnes of Saf.

“That’s sufficient to fulfill about half of the mandated Saf demand in 2030.

“We’re not the one reply – we want the opposite routes to Saf – however this new path to Saf has the potential to maneuver the needle, it has the potential to be a major contribution to UK Saf provide.

“And never simply the UK in fact. Wherever on this planet the place there are folks, there’s poo.”

Firefly mentioned it’s within the strategy of acquiring regulatory approval for its system for use to gasoline plane.

Wizz Air additionally introduced a brand new aspiration to energy 10% of its flights with Saf by 2030.

Yvonne Moynihan, company and ESG (environmental, social and governance) officer at Wizz Air, mentioned: “Wizz Air celebrates twenty years of transformation this 12 months, transitioning from a small airline into a worldwide chief of sustainable aviation and inexpensive journey.

“Alongside fleet renewal and operational effectivity, sustainable aviation gasoline performs an important position in decreasing carbon emissions from aviation.

“Our funding in Firefly, which has the potential to cut back our lifecycle emissions by 100,000 tonnes CO2 equal per 12 months, underscores our dedication to mainstream the usage of Saf in our operations by 2030.

“Nevertheless, attaining our aspiration requires a major ramp-up of Saf manufacturing and deployment.

“Due to this fact, we name on policymakers to handle obstacles to Saf deployment at scale by incentivising manufacturing, offering value help, and embracing extra sustainable feedstocks for biofuel manufacturing.”

Below the Authorities’s Saf mandate, at the very least 10% of the gasoline utilized by airways within the UK have to be produced from sustainable feedstocks by 2030.
